Turning waste to power S.I.D.S.

BIOGAS-POWERED: Mina Weydahl tops up one of the 15 golf carts that will be transporting delegates around the S.I.D.S venue.The thousands of delegates in Samoa for the S.I.D.S Conference will be transported around Tuana’imato over the next few days using very unique golf carts.

The 10-seater carts will be powered by energy generated from turning kitchen scraps into electricity.

Yesterday, the media and S.I.D.S delegates were invited to find out more about the biogas project at the S.I.D.S Village.

Energy Analyst, Mina Weydahl, said the project is exciting.

“ This partners hip will demonstrate at S.I.D.S how everyday organic waste, kitchen scraps can be used to produce biogas for cooking and lighting,” she said.

“Many Pacific island countries like Palau, Kiribati including Samoa are looking at ways of moving away from its heavy reliance on expensive petroleum products.”

She assured that producing energy using organic waste would help communities to access affordable electricity.

Biogas is mostly methane and it’s formed when bacteria break down organic waste underwater.

A.C.E.O of M.N.R.E, Sala Sagato, said Samoa is delighted to be able to turn such waste into electricity.

“There are other developments within Samoa itself that sees the using of biogas like the pilot sanitation projects at Vaitele- Fou,” he said.
